• Central Ohio is bracing for a wet and stormy Memorial Day weekend, with the National Weather Service issuing a hazardous weather outlook for the region. Strong to severe thunderstorms are expected to develop on May 19, bringing damaging winds and large hail. Rain is likely to impact the Bruno Mars concert at Ohio Stadium on May 20, with an 80% chance of precipitation. • The unsettled weather pattern is forecasted to persist through the holiday weekend, with rain and thunderstorms likely on May 22 and May 23, and a 30-40% chance of precipitation continuing into Memorial Day.

Why It's Important?

The primary risks include damaging winds and large hail associated with severe thunderstorms, particularly on May 19. Outdoor events, including the Bruno Mars concert, may face disruptions due to heavy rain and potential lightning. Travel and outdoor activities during the Memorial Day weekend could also be affected by persistent wet conditions. Residents are advised to monitor weather updates and prepare for possible severe weather impacts.
